Abstract[English]
The present invention discloses a state of conical photovoltaic system with solar panel mount on a conical base whose height is modular in nature and can be increased or decreased to manipulate the power output. The structural design allows increased solar irradiance, hence increased power output per area on the ground vis-à-vis a conventional flat-bed solar panel. The present invention allows facilitate a self-cleaning assembly with a motion controlled by the motion of a vertical axis wind turbine and hence an efficient maintenance of the solar panel is done without additional costs and any external power consumption.[French]
